Prairie Grove Man Accused Of Choking Wife

— Police arrested a Prairie Grove man Wednesday after he reportedly choked, smothered and restrained his wife.

Duryl Mixon, 30, of 214 N. Pittman St. faces felony charges in connection with aggravated assault, first-degree battery and interference with emergency communication.

According to a preliminary arrest report, Mixon and his wife got into an argument, during which Mixon choked and smothered her repeatedly, causing her to lose consciousness and hit her head on a cement curb.

She said she bit and scratched Mixon. She told police she tried to escape and was unable to use her cell phone. Police said Mixon took the battery from his wife’s phone so she couldn’t call for help.

He was arrested and taken to the Washington County Detention Center where he was being held on a $7,500 bond Thursday. He’s expected to make his first appearance in Washington County Circuit Court today.
